2.1 Built-in Stitches and Stitch Applications
The Singer Tradition 2277 features 23 built-in stitches‚ including basic‚ decorative‚ and stretch stitches‚ with 97 stitch applications for versatility. It offers adjustable stitch width and a one-step buttonhole function‚ making it ideal for various fabric types and sewing projects. The machine’s stitch customization options allow users to tailor their work‚ ensuring precision and creativity in every seam.
2.2 Maximum Speed and Drop Feed Function
The Singer Tradition 2277 operates at a maximum speed of 750 stitches per minute‚ offering efficient sewing for various projects. It features a drop feed function‚ enabling free-motion sewing for tasks like quilting or embroidery. To activate‚ users can lower the feed dogs using the included darning plate‚ providing flexibility and control for creative stitching and intricate designs.

3.1 Step-by-Step Threading Guide
To thread the Singer Tradition 2277‚ start by ensuring the machine is turned off and unplugged. Place the thread on the spool pin and gently pull it through the machine’s tension guide. Follow the arrows on the machine to guide the thread through the take-up lever and into the stitch selector. Set the top tension knob to 4 for balanced stitching. Wind the thread around the bobbin a few times‚ trim the excess‚ and insert it into the bobbin case. Pull the thread to set the bobbin tension‚ then bring the end of the thread up through the throat plate near the needle. Pull both the top and bobbin threads to secure them and test the machine on scrap fabric to ensure even stitches. If issues arise‚ rethread or adjust tension as needed.

4.1 Routine Maintenance Tips
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ance of the Singer Tradition 2277. Clean the machine thoroughly‚ removing dust and lint from the bobbin area and feed dogs. Lubricate moving parts periodically to prevent friction. Check and replace needles regularly to avoid breakage. Always use the correct needle type for your fabric to prevent damage. Refer to the manual for specific guidelines on oiling and adjusting tension for smooth operation. Proper care extends the machine’s lifespan.
4.2 Common Issues and Solutions
Common issues with the Singer Tradition 2277 include needle breakage‚ thread jams‚ and uneven stitches. Needle breakage often results from using the wrong needle type or improper fabric guidance. Thread jams can be resolved by re-threading the machine and ensuring the bobbin is correctly inserted. For uneven stitches‚ adjust the tension settings or clean the machine. Regular maintenance and proper threading can prevent many of these issues. Always consult the manual for troubleshooting guidance.

7.2 Adjusting Stitch Width and Length
The Singer Tradition 2277 allows easy adjustment of stitch width and length using convenient dials. Stitch width can be set between 0-5mm‚ and stitch length ranges from 0-4mm‚ enabling precise control for various fabrics and sewing techniques. This feature ensures stitches can be customized to achieve the desired effect‚ whether for delicate fabrics or heavy-duty projects‚ enhancing flexibility and creativity in sewing tasks.

8.1 Choosing the Right Needle for Fabric Type
Selecting the appropriate needle for your fabric type is crucial for optimal sewing performance. Use a universal needle for general sewing‚ sharp needles for woven fabrics‚ and ballpoint needles for stretch or knit fabrics. Heavy-duty needles are ideal for thick materials like denim. Always refer to the needle package for specific fabric recommendations to ensure compatibility and prevent breakage. Proper needle selection enhances stitch quality and extends needle life.
8.2 Managing Fabric Thickness and Guidance
For managing fabric thickness‚ use the appropriate presser foot and adjust the stitch length and width. Thicker fabrics may require a heavier needle and slower sewing speed. Use a walking foot or Teflon foot for smooth guidance on heavy or slippery fabrics; Always guide the fabric steadily to maintain consistent stitch quality and prevent bunching or dragging‚ ensuring professional-looking results for all projects.

9.1 Free-Motion Sewing with the Drop Feed
The Singer Tradition 2277’s drop feed function enables free-motion sewing‚ allowing for precise control over stitching. To use this feature‚ lower the feed dogs using the machine’s mechanism or attach the included darning plate. This setup is ideal for quilting‚ embroidery‚ or repairing delicate fabrics. With the feed dogs disengaged‚ the fabric moves freely under the needle‚ giving you creative flexibility for intricate designs and custom stitching patterns.
9.2 Sewing Buttonholes in One Step
The Singer Tradition 2277 simplifies buttonhole sewing with its one-step automatic feature. Place your fabric under the buttonhole foot‚ aligning the marks. Select the buttonhole stitch and let the machine create perfectly sized buttonholes in one continuous motion. This feature ensures consistent results‚ saving time and effort for projects like dresses‚ shirts‚ or crafts. The machine’s automation makes it easy to achieve professional-looking buttonholes with minimal effort.
